Pros

  • Charming fantasy world and atmosphere
  • Engaging fairy collection and evolution system
  • Unique fps-style fairy battles
  • Nostalgic and captivating story
  • Excellent music and sound design

Cons

  • Technical issues and poor optimization on modern systems
  • Dated graphics and interface
  • Menu lag and control problems
  • Grindy progression and repetitive battles
  • Lack of multiplayer support and achievements
